Name: Ether's Blessing, Quick Draw Style - Parry
Tier: D - Tier
Cost: 10 Stamina
Weapon Type: Sword/Short Sword and Sheath
Class: Defensive
Range: 1 Meters
Duration: Instant
Cool-Down: 2 Posts
Description: A parry technique geared for the Ether Blessing style of swordsmanship. It consists of a careful analysis of the path of the enemy's attack and by, swiftly drawing the sword from it's sheath to strike the opponents weapon, altering the course of the attack with a single swing in order for the user to defend his or herself before re-sheathing the blade. This technique requires a above average amount of intuition, speed and experience to be properly utilized as well as great footwork. It inflicts no damage and the blade travels at a speed of 10 m/s. It can defend against one C -Tier physical attack or 2 D- Tier physical attacks.

Name: Ether's Blessing. Quick Draw Style -
Reaper's Parry
Tier: D - Tier
Cost: 10 Stamina
Weapon Type: Sheath Only
Class: Defensive
Range: 2 Meters
Duration: Instant
Cool-Down: 2 Posts
Description: Guardian's parry is a complex technique which consists of the user carefully analyzing the path of the enemy's attack and then, swiftly using the sheath of the sword with the blade still inside, to touch the enemy's weapon and deviant it off the course. Redirecting it downward path to fend of any danger before grabbing the hilt of the sword with the other hand. This will in turn create a single opening since the opponent will be unable to re-position his/her weapon for a single second. Immediately after utilizing this defense, the user can execute another one of his/her techniques, normally against the upper body though he/she may intend to, it isn't a necessity. Of course, even when successfully utilized and a technique had been used immediately after, there is still a chance that said ability will not be successful. This technique requires a above average amount of intuition, speed and experience to be properly utilized as well as great footwork. It can defend against one C -Tier physical attack or 2 D- Tier physical attacks.

Name: Ether's Blessing, Quick Draw Style - Initiative
Tier: D - Rank
Cost: 10 Stamina
Weapon Type: Sword/Short Sword and Sheath
Class: Offensive
Range: 5 Meters
Duration: 1 Post
Cool-Down: 2 Posts
Description: A common yet important technique within the Ether's Blessing Swordsmanship style. It takes advantage of both the user's speed and the characteristics of the sword he/she is wielding (thin, short, sharp and light) to swiftly move in, execute a horizontal slash, sheath the blade and return to his original position all in a graceful two step motion without losing his footing. One must observe the enemy carefully if they were to maximize the effectiveness of this technique. If successful, it could cut through skin and penetrate some of the flesh for minor injuries. It has a maximum speed limit of 10 m/s when moving towards the opponent.

Name: Ether's Blessing, Quick Draw Style - Ungodly Descent
Tier: C - Tier
Cost: 20 Stamina
Weapon Type: Sword/ Short Sword and sheath
Class: Offensive
Range: Leap: 1 - 15 Meters| Quick Draw: 5 Meters
Duration: 1 Post
Cool-Down: 2 Posts
Description: Ungodly Descent is a more difficult technique that requires precision timing, speed and decent analytic skills in order to properly utilize. This technique requires the user to have a firm hand on the hilt of his/her weapon before they would spring of their feet and preform a cartwheel over their opponent and land behind them to create a reveal a hidden opening or create multiple ones. This is then followed by the user quickly drawing his/her sword upon landing for a diagonal cut that would penetrate through skin and halfway through the muscle before the user would then sheath his/her sword. The cartwheel itself can rang from 1 to 15 meters while the attack itself has a rang of 5 meters. The cartwheel has a maximized speed limit of 5 m/s while the quick draw has a limit of 10 m/s.
